The bill proposes the repeal of the Driver and Vehicle Systems Oversight Committee, specifically targeting Laws 2019, First Special Session chapter 3, article 2, section 34, as amended by Laws 2020, chapter 100, section 22. The new legal language inserted into the current law includes a clear statement of repeal, indicating the removal of the committee and its associated provisions. This action signifies a shift in the oversight structure related to driver and vehicle systems in Minnesota.
By repealing the Oversight Committee, the bill effectively dissolves the framework established for monitoring and managing the implementation of the Vehicle Title and Registration System (VTRS) and the decommissioning of the Minnesota Licensing and Registration System (MNLARS). The bill's effective date is set for the day following its final enactment, which will lead to immediate changes in the governance of state driver and vehicle systems.
